How Many Pages Can WordPress Handle? A Comprehensive Guide to WordPress Scalability

Table of Contents

  1. Introduction
  2. Understanding WordPress Scalability
  3. Real-World Examples of WordPress Scalability
  4. Best Practices for Managing Large WordPress Sites
  5. The Importance of Professional Support
  6. Addressing Common Concerns
  7. Conclusion
  8. FAQ

Introduction

Did you know that the average website has about 15 pages, yet some websites boast thousands or even millions of pages? This staggering fact highlights a critical question for many businesses and webmasters: how many pages can WordPress handle?

In the world of WordPress, there is no hard limit on the number of pages you can create. The platform is designed to be scalable, allowing users to manage content efficiently. However, while WordPress itself can support an unlimited number of pages, the actual performance largely depends on your hosting environment and the resources allocated to your site.

This blog post aims to explore the intricacies of WordPress scalability, performance implications, and best practices for managing a vast number of pages. We will also delve into how Premium WP Support can assist you in optimizing your WordPress site for growth. Are you ready to discover how to make the most of WordPress’s capabilities for your business?

Understanding WordPress Scalability

The Basics of WordPress Architecture

WordPress is built on a robust architecture that allows it to handle various types of content. At its core, WordPress uses a combination of PHP and MySQL to manage data and serve webpages. This structure enables it to be flexible and dynamic, catering to a wide range of websites—from personal blogs to large corporate sites.

  1. Dynamic Content: Each page on a WordPress site is generated dynamically based on the requests made by users. This means that even if your site has thousands of pages, WordPress can serve them efficiently, provided the server can handle the load.
  2. Database Management: WordPress stores all content in a MySQL database. As more pages are added, the database grows. However, a well-optimized database can handle vast amounts of data without significant slowdowns.
  3. Caching Mechanisms: To enhance performance, WordPress utilizes caching plugins and techniques. These can dramatically reduce load times and improve user experience, especially on large sites.

The Role of Hosting in Scalability

While WordPress itself can handle unlimited pages, the hosting environment plays a crucial role in determining how well your site performs under load. Here are some key factors to consider:

  • Server Resources: The amount of RAM, CPU, and storage available on your server directly affects how many concurrent users your site can support without slowing down.
  • Type of Hosting: Shared hosting may suffice for smaller sites, but as your page count grows, dedicated or VPS hosting becomes essential. This allows for better resource allocation and performance optimization.
  • Content Delivery Network (CDN): Integrating a CDN can help distribute the load across multiple servers, improving load times and reducing server strain.

Performance Considerations

When scaling your WordPress site, performance is paramount. A slow website can lead to high bounce rates and negatively impact SEO. Here are some performance considerations:

  • Page Load Speed: Aim for a load time of under three seconds. Tools like Google PageSpeed Insights can help analyze your site’s performance and identify bottlenecks.
  • Database Optimization: Regularly clean and optimize your database to remove unnecessary data, reducing its size and improving performance.
  • Image Optimization: Large images can slow down your site significantly. Use plugins to compress images and serve them in next-gen formats like WebP.
  • Plugin Management: Too many plugins can lead to conflicts and slowdowns. Regularly review and manage the plugins installed on your site.

Real-World Examples of WordPress Scalability

Case Study: A Content-Heavy Website

Imagine a digital magazine that publishes multiple articles daily. With a goal of maintaining an extensive archive, the site aims to host tens of thousands of articles over time. To manage this, they implemented several strategies:

  1. Optimized Hosting: They upgraded to a VPS hosting plan with 4GB of RAM and dedicated resources, providing ample capacity for concurrent users.
  2. Effective Use of Caching: By employing caching plugins, they reduced server requests and improved load times, enhancing user experience.
  3. Database Management: The magazine regularly performed maintenance on their database, ensuring it remained optimized and efficient.

As a result, the site successfully managed over 50,000 pages without significant performance drops, illustrating that with the right strategies, WordPress can seamlessly handle extensive content.

Case Study: An E-commerce Platform

In contrast, consider an e-commerce site that features thousands of products. The challenges here are different:

  • Dynamic Page Generation: Each product page is created dynamically, which can be resource-intensive.
  • Traffic Spikes: E-commerce sites often experience traffic spikes during sales events. Proper hosting and resource allocation are critical.

To address these challenges, the e-commerce site invested in:

  1. High-Performance Hosting: They opted for a dedicated server with scalable resources, ensuring that they could handle surges in traffic.
  2. CDN Integration: By using a CDN, they distributed content globally, improving load times for users regardless of their location.
  3. Regular Performance Audits: They conducted regular audits to identify and rectify performance issues proactively.

This approach enabled them to efficiently manage their extensive product catalog while providing a seamless shopping experience.

Best Practices for Managing Large WordPress Sites

To ensure that your WordPress site can handle a large number of pages effectively, consider implementing these best practices:

1. Choose the Right Hosting Plan

Selecting the appropriate hosting plan is crucial for scalability. Consider factors such as:

  • Expected traffic
  • Number of pages
  • Resource requirements

At Premium WP Support, we recommend exploring our comprehensive WordPress services to find a hosting plan tailored to your needs. Explore our service packages.

2. Optimize for Speed

Site speed is critical for user satisfaction and SEO. Here are some optimization techniques:

  • Minimize HTTP Requests: Reduce the number of elements on each page to speed up loading times.
  • Use Lazy Loading: This technique delays loading images and videos until they are visible in the viewport, improving initial load times.
  • Optimize CSS and JavaScript: Combine and minify CSS and JavaScript files to reduce load times.

3. Implement a Strong Caching Strategy

Caching is one of the most effective ways to enhance performance. Consider using:

  • Page Caching: Store a static version of your pages to reduce server load.
  • Object Caching: Store database query results for faster retrieval, especially for frequently accessed data.

4. Regular Maintenance and Updates

Regularly maintaining your site is essential for optimal performance:

  • Update WordPress Core, Themes, and Plugins: Keeping everything updated ensures you benefit from performance improvements and security patches.
  • Back-Up Your Site Regularly: Regular backups protect your data and allow for easy recovery in case of issues.
  • Monitor Performance: Use tools like Google Analytics and performance monitoring tools to keep an eye on your site’s performance.

The Importance of Professional Support

While managing a WordPress site with a large number of pages can be manageable, professional support can significantly ease the process. At Premium WP Support, we pride ourselves on our commitment to professionalism and reliability. Our team is dedicated to empowering businesses with effective WordPress solutions tailored to their unique needs.

If you’re looking to optimize your WordPress site for scalability and performance, we invite you to book your free, no-obligation consultation today. Our experts are ready to help you navigate the complexities of WordPress management.

Addressing Common Concerns

How Many Pages Can I Safely Add to My WordPress Site?

As mentioned earlier, WordPress does not impose a specific limit on the number of pages. However, the safe number of pages you can add largely depends on your hosting resources. For websites with high traffic or resource-intensive applications, it is wise to monitor performance closely after adding significant numbers of pages.

Will Having More Pages Slow Down My Site?

The simple answer is: it can. If your hosting environment is not equipped to handle the increased load, adding more pages could negatively impact performance. That’s why it’s crucial to ensure that your hosting plan is adequate for your expected growth.

What Types of Hosting Are Best for Large WordPress Sites?

For larger WordPress sites, we recommend:

  • VPS Hosting: Offers dedicated resources and better performance than shared hosting.
  • Dedicated Servers: Provides maximum control and resources for high-traffic sites.
  • Managed WordPress Hosting: Tailored specifically for WordPress, offering optimizations and support.

Can I Use WordPress for E-commerce with Thousands of Products?

Absolutely! WordPress, with plugins like WooCommerce, is a powerful platform for e-commerce. However, just like any other large site, it requires proper hosting and optimization strategies to manage thousands of products effectively.

Conclusion

In conclusion, WordPress is a highly scalable platform capable of handling a vast number of pages, limited primarily by your hosting resources. By implementing best practices for performance optimization and managing your hosting environment effectively, your WordPress site can thrive, regardless of size.

At Premium WP Support, we understand the challenges that come with managing a large WordPress site, and we are here to provide the expertise and support you need. Whether you’re just starting or looking to optimize an existing site, we invite you to explore our comprehensive WordPress services or book your free, no-obligation consultation today. Let us help you unlock the full potential of your WordPress site!

FAQ

Can WordPress handle high traffic?

Yes, WordPress can handle high traffic if hosted on a suitable plan with adequate resources. Proper optimization and caching techniques can also enhance performance.

Is there a maximum number of pages I can create in WordPress?

No, WordPress does not impose a maximum limit on the number of pages. However, performance will depend on your hosting capabilities.

What should I do if my WordPress site becomes slow with many pages?

If your site slows down, consider upgrading your hosting plan, optimizing your database, and implementing caching solutions.

How do I know if my hosting plan is sufficient?

Monitor your site’s performance and resource usage. If you experience slow load times or crashes during traffic spikes, it may be time to upgrade your hosting plan.

Leave a Reply

Your email address will not be published. Required fields are marked *

Time limit is exhausted. Please reload the CAPTCHA.

Premium WordPress Support
Privacy Overview

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.